赞了回答2017-06-22
正则表达式有一个lastIndex属性,它表示下次匹配从字符串的第几个字符开始,初始值是0;如果没有g选项,每次匹配完之后,lastIndex的值会变为0;如果有g选项,如果匹配成功,则lastIndex变成匹配字符串后面的位置,如果没有匹配成功,则lastIndex重置为0;lastIndex...
发布了文章2017-06-17
知道我的人都知道我是做在线教育,准确的应该说是高中生在线一对一辅导平台。 这个平台最核心的服务应该就是上课服务了,这个上课服务里面包含着什么呢?我来列一下: 白板互动系统(屏幕共享系统) 语音即使通讯系统 文字即时通讯系统 课件中心 题库中心 其他服务先...
回答了问题2017-06-14
10000条不算多的,只是不能用PHPExcel,因为实在太慢了而且容易爆内存。我写过一个 [链接] ,专门用来简单的Excel导出的,可以使用一下。
发布了文章2016-12-10
最近业务系统中经常会报:短信无法发送成功,关键词屏蔽的错误。一个原因随着业务的发展人名重复的次数增加了。第二个自然是我们国家特殊的国情导致的。
赞了文章2016-11-30
2016年作为视频直播元年,无论从资本层面不断高涨的估值,到平台主播各种天文数字的报酬,再到像“局座”这样的主流人士争相上直播,直播的社会热度可见一斑。而各大直播平台在经历了直播概念从无到有的阶段后,如何做出差异化,如何解决在野蛮生长期产生的各种涉黄问...
发布了文章2016-10-24
公司系统里面有一个服务是 PDF2JPG (实际上应该是 PPT2JPG, 只是PPT2PDF这一步骤我们利用七牛的云服务来完成。) 早期的时候我们根据系统负载已经实际情况采用了 crontab 来定时获取数据库需要转换的数据。所以这个服务的QPS是 1/60 QPS。是的,你没看错就是这么低,...
发布了文章2016-09-28
众所周知 PHP 是一种脚本语言,脚本语言主要是使用解释运行而非编译运行。所以相对于编译型语言(C、C#、C++),它没有直接生成exedll的能力。所以传统型的加密方式加壳它使用不上。
发布了文章2016-09-26
先说环境: {代码...} 实战过程 手头上有一个加密过的项目和一个php扩展的动态连接库(jinhou.so)。 PHP代码类似如下的样子: {代码...} 根据上面分析到的已知条件有: 加密方式类似 eval 的加密方式。 jhgo 包含执行代码跟解密代码。 jinhou.so 里面包含 jhgo 函数。...
赞了文章2016-07-12
Clouditor 是基于我前些天的一些想法整理出来一个原型项目,简单说呢, 我觉得编辑器的侧边栏应该显示调用栈而不是文件树,具体的一些我录了视频, 应该还是能说清楚的:
赞了回答2016-05-17
没有c++文法,无法直接对c++文法进行分析。不过github上有一个包含大部分语言(也包括c++) antlr格式的语法文件集合。cpp14的语法文件在这里
赞了回答2016-03-20
这是ES6的新feature,function 后面带 * 的叫做generator。 在generator内部你可以使用 yield 语句:
发布了文章2015-11-27
最近使用swoole开发一个斗地主服务端的代理层,任务不难,排除几个swoole的 segment fault(注1) 都好说。通俗点说就是将socket转变成websocket。这个很简单,关键的是也不知道哪个混蛋在最初的时候不使用浏览器的 typed array 去解析协议而是想到了将协议 struct ...
回答了问题2015-11-26
1、语法、文法 可以在 [链接] 找找啊 肯定找到的 生成AST就可以进行分析了。2.尼玛 看 Document去3.我操 for 啊 4.Google a
赞了文章2014-09-10
智能手机存在一个手指问题。触摸屏是一个神奇的发明,但它绝对有缺点。 我们的手指是不透明的,这是最突出的问题。手指遮住了屏幕。 你的手指也不是很尖。手指与屏幕的接触面积相当大并且显得笨拙,这使得我们很难选择文字或点击一个非常精确微小的点。 这就是发明光...
赞了回答2014-08-11
其实,这里最好用“好处”这个词来代替“用处”,因为传统的Web接口实现方式同样能够实现业务需要(所以这不是一个必须的事情,需要自己根据业务需求综合判断是否需要采用),而改用“RESTful风格”会有一些额外的“好处”:
回答了问题2014-08-11
阻塞有两种一种是客户端的阻塞:浏览器对于同域名的并发连接是有限制的,如果超出了这个限制,那么浏览器对于后续的请求都是处于阻塞状态的。这也是为什么有专门的静态资源服务器的原因之一,连接数的限制如下(引用自 浏览器允许的并发请求资源数是什么意思?):
赞了回答2014-08-11
居然没看到symfony2的 symfony2 基于symfony2的一些web service的bundle FOSRestBundleFOSOAuthServerBundleJMSSerializerBundleNelmioApiDocBundleRequestLimitBundleRateLimitBundleBazingaHateoasBundleKnpJsonSchemaBundleLexikJWTAuthenticationBundleResourceB...
回答了问题2014-08-11
推荐一个 recess 应该会对你有所启发,restful 关键不在于框架的选择,而是你如何理解、实现restful。相比于其他框架,我更喜欢 recess 使用 Annotation 来实现的Router的方式,但显然性能差了点。当然它能在 Annotation 数据跟权限的 Validation 更好了。
回答了问题2014-07-25
什么场景、业务、背景都不说,就说mongo为什么比mysql快?你用过两者么?你是来黑mysql吧。去学习下如何提问题吧!
赞了回答2014-07-25
不能说的这么绝对,有很多时候 mongo 并不一定比MySQL快